Influence on Entertainment Content

The "Naughty Rich Girls" have significantly influenced entertainment content, contributing to a shift towards more provocative and unapologetic storytelling. Shows like "The Hills," "The Real Housewives" franchise, and "Summer House" have capitalized on the allure of wealthy, young adults living extravagant lifestyles, often marked by partying, romantic entanglements, and interpersonal drama. These programs not only attract large audiences but also set the stage for a new generation of influencers and celebrities.

Moreover, the scripted television and film industries have taken note of the "Naughty Rich Girls'" appeal, incorporating characters and storylines that reflect the public's interest in the lifestyles of the affluent and the morally ambiguous. Movies like "The Wolf of Wall Street" and "Girls Trip" showcase characters who embody the "Naughty Rich Girl" spirit, albeit in varying degrees and contexts.
